Actuator device for a bicycle gearshift and nut for such a device

1. Actuator device for a bicycle gearshift, comprising:

  • an actuation kinematic mechanism adapted to be articulated in order to move a derailleur of the gearshift;

    a driving member adapted to control the articulation of the actuation kinematic mechanism, the driving member comprising a motor and a threaded drive shaft put in rotation by the motor;

    a nut associated with the actuation kinematic mechanism and with the drive shaft so that, in a first operative configuration of the actuator device, the nut is in an engaged condition with the drive shaft such that the rotation of the drive shaft causes the articulation of the actuation kinematic mechanism;

    wherein said actuator device further comprises a biased snap mechanism that holds the nut in said engaged condition under a predetermined threshold biasing force, and releases the nut such that the nut is drivingly disengaged from the drive shaft after said actuator device is subjected to a second force that overcomes the predetermined threshold biasing force and rotation of the drive shaft does not cause the articulation of the actuation kinematic mechanism.
